Stannah Lifts

Stannah Lifts Holdings Ltd is a manufacturer of lifts based in Andover, Hampshire. Founded in 1867 in London as a crane and hoist manufacturer, the company began to produce lifts shortly after. Although varying types of lifts are manufactured by the company, it is best known for its stairlifts with which the company's name has become synonymous.
The company headquarters and stairlift division are located within the Portway Industrial Estate on the western outskirts of Andover. ==History==
The company was founded in London in 1867 by Joseph Stannah, who had worked as an engineer since the 1820s. Initially a manufacturer of cranes and hoists for transporting ships' cargo, the company began to make hand-powered passenger lifts at the turn of the 20th century.〔 Its first headquarters were located on Southwark Bridge Road, before moving to Bankside in the early 20th century. The company remained here until the site was destroyed during the London Blitz. The chairman at the time, Leslie Stannah, built new headquarters at Tiverton Street, Southwark using compensation money awarded to the company.
Stannah Lifts moved from London to Andover in 1974, produced its first stairlift the following year, and began exporting in 1979.〔 From there, it established itself as the leading manufacturer of stairlifts worldwide, as well as Britain's largest lift manufacturer.〔 Subsidiaries were opened in the United States and The Netherlands in 1992, and Slovakia in 2003. The company also purchased distributors in Ireland in 2005, and Norway in 2010.〔 The company produced its 500,000th stairlift in February 2011 during a visit by the Prince of Wales to the Andover headquarters.
